Mobility Scooter Buyers Near Me

A mobility scooter can greatly improve the quality of life of those who have limited movement. Even simple things, like going to the supermarket or to a park, can have a big impact on their mental and emotional health.

Before you purchase a scooter you should consider some important aspects. These factors include:

Cost

It's important to take into account the cost of purchasing a mobility device. They're expensive however they can make a major difference to the life of a person. They can help them get to shops and other public areas without relying on a caregiver or a friend to transport them, and they can provide them with the feeling of independence.

The cost of a scooter for mobility is dependent on a number of factors which include its type and size. In general smaller models are less expensive than larger ones. However, the capacity to weight and battery power can affect the price. You should visit a store and try out a variety of models before making a final choice.

Many times, seniors who require mobility scooters are able to receive financial aid for the device through Medicare. In certain instances Medicare will cover up to 80% of the cost. However, it is advised to speak with your doctor and insurance provider to ensure that all eligibility requirements are met.

In addition to the cost of the scooter, seniors might also be required to pay for other features or accessories. This could include items like a basket bag or cup holder, and rearview mirror. These add-ons can increase the overall cost of the scooter and some senior citizens may not be able afford them.

Another consideration is the availability of maintenance services. Most newer mobility equipment comes with warranties that cover service and repair. However, this isn't always the case for used equipment. For this reason, it's important to find out whether the used scooter you're looking to purchase is well-maintained. The seller will be able to provide you with records of maintenance that indicate the date when the battery was replaced or if any parts were repaired or replaced.

Some people who are unable to purchase a new scooter could find that a used one is more affordable. In some instances a used scooter may even be more durable than a brand new one. A used scooter can help you save money on shipping and delivery charges.

Repairability

A mobility scooter can be a lifesaver to those with a limited ability to walk. However, it's not indestructible and can break down from time to period. The good news is that most failures can be avoided with some preventative maintenance. The key is to keep alert for warning signs and to act swiftly. If your scooter starts to shake or sputter when you drive it is possible that it is time to replace the battery. Also, if you hear the sound of a thump-thump when you hit bumps it could be because the tires need replacing.

You can have your scooter fixed free of charge if it's covered by a warranty. Many businesses offer warranties of up to five years. These warranties include both parts and labor. Some scooters offer lifetime guarantees on certain components. You can also get warranties on accessories that will make the scooter more comfortable and comfortable.

On the market, you can find a wide range of scooters, ranging from tiny model for travel up to heavy-duty ones. Most of these scooters have seating cushions, headlights, and storage space. Some have a lift to help transport the scooter inside a car, while others can be disassembled into parts which can be put in the trunk of a standard car.

Think about your budget the way you live and your preferences when selecting the right scooter. If you intend to use the scooter between buildings or at home it is possible that a lighter model would be ideal. On the other on the other hand, if your plan is to use it on the sidewalks and parks the heavier, more robust model may be better.

It is also a good idea, prior to purchasing a scooter to verify the insurance coverage. Certain insurance plans and Medicare Part B will cover scooters when they are considered medically necessary. You will require a prescription as well as a declaration of medical necessity from your physician to qualify.

A second-hand scooter is a great option to save. You can find them at many places including high-street retailers and specialist retailers. You can also look for a short-term loan program that is offered by local councils or shopmobility.
